About Singleron

Founded in 2018, Singleron develops and commercializes single cell multi-omics products that can be used in both research and clinical settings. Its current product portfolio includes instruments, microfluidic devices, reagents, software analysis and database solutions that facilitate high-throughput single cell analysis. Singleron’s sample services offer expert execution and generation of high-quality results for academia, clinics, and biotech.

The company currently has offices, laboratories, and manufacturing facilities in Germany, Singapore, China, and the US. Its products are used in over 2,000 laboratories in hospitals, research institutes, and pharmaceutical companies.


About Sciomics

Sciomics has extensive expertise in the field of biomarker discovery, in vitro and in vivo. Their model system characterisation and disease mechanism profiling use high-content protein and post-translational modification profiling. Currently, this results in over 1,400 analysed proteins by using their proprietary fully immuno-based scioDiscover antibody array platform in a single assay with minimal sample requirements combined with Machine Learning assisted data analysis. The high-content and high-throughput platform guarantees robust and reproducible results which can be easily translated into validation and clinical assays. Sciomics serves customers world-wide, focussing on the European and North American market.
